Summary

About the role:
To provide legal advice to the Council/Housing Service on the following:
• landlord and tenant law,
• statutory duty of care,
• homelessness/disrepair
• the acquisition and disposal of property and the development of housing policy and process
• advice in respect to specific letters, disputes or other matters
• detailed advice on complex cases
• advice on leaseholder agreements, consultation and sale covenants
About you:
A thorough knowledge of Housing Law and Court procedure.
A Solicitor or Fellow of the Institute of Legal Executives

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
